WHAT DOES SUSHI TASTE LIKE IN AN AMATEUR'S FIRST BITE ...
May 20, 2017 · THE TASTE OF SUSHI. Sushi generally has a tangy taste due to the vinegared rice. Apart from it, the second thing that gives sushi a distinct taste is the fish topping. Salmon, tuna, and eel have a very light flavor while octopus has a stronger flavor.

WHAT DOES HOKKIGAI SUSHI TASTE LIKE? – FOOD & DRINK
What Does Hokkigai Sushi Taste Like? The clam Hokkigai is popular for sashimi, and it has a meaty texture and sweet flavor, while akagai clams have a mild, subtle taste. WHAT DOES SUSHI TASTE LIKE? AND OTHER QUESTIONS
Dec 07, 2021 · What Does Sushi Taste Like? Although sushi rice is flavored with vinegar and literally means “sour taste,” the rice itself is not usually very sour by Western standards. In fact, most sushi rice that you get at restaurants is actually a little sweet to the taste.

OFTEN ASKED: WHAT DOES IKURA SUSHI TASTE LIKE? - THE ...
Often asked: What Does Ikura Sushi Taste Like? They’re salty, very savory, rich in umami, and a bit more fishy than most other sushi items—potentially making ikura one of the more controversial types of sushi. Unlike other roes used in sushi like tobiko and masago, combining ikura with other ingredients is uncommon.

Nigiri sushi isn’t rolled like maki. Instead, a thin slice of raw or cooked fish is layered atop a mound of vinegary rice. Typically, a small amount of wasabi is placed between the fish and the rice, though in some case, a small strip of toasted seaweed, or nori, may be used instead.
